Vista Greens, Keller, TX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Vista Greens?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Vista Greens 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,626 | $1,400 | $1,920 |
| Vista Greens 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,132 | $900 | $3,500 |
| Vista Greens 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,787 | $1,895 | $6,000 |
| Vista Greens 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,080 | $2,700 | $6,750 |
| Vista Greens 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,113 | $2,939 | $4,700 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Vista Greens
What type of rentals are currently available in Vista Greens?
There are currently 43 Apartments for Rent in Vista Greens, TX with pricing that ranges from $1,118 to $8,990. There are also 242 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Vista Greens ranging from $900 to $6,750.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Vista Greens?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Vista Greens ranges from $900 to $6,750 with an average monthly rent of $2,634.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Vista Greens?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Vista Greens range from $1,682 to $3,875,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$900 to $3,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,895 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,535.
